With the clam off I stood on the front corner chassis in front of the wheels and bounced, the front right is hard against the bump stop and made an unhealthy noise, the front left moved but it's lower than it should be.

There was only a few mm height between them on the threads but the right is right though it's travel, it was the camber on the wheel that caused me to look closer, then I saw how much it was compressed. Then looked at my arches and both fronts have been hitting hard against the 'a pillar' bit which they only used to just scuff on the odd occasion.

That's why your left looks a little low but is probably ok. It's being pulled down by the other side that obviously has an issue. Undo the ARB and I'll bet it'll pop back up most of the way.

Well the roll bar was straight and disconnected the front right still sits down on its bump stop.

Either way it didn't slow me down and I managed to race no problem on it and win, fastest lap time of the whole race meeting (16 races and 7series) with a 56.4 in the damp.

My black art designs set up will be with me in the next couple of days, the result of all the measurements and calculations is a spring rate of 900lb fronts and 1100lb rears. Will be interesting to see how the set up feels at Donny and how the car reacts to the change.
